Cranberry is a pleasant community in Butler County 20 miles north of Pittsburgh. This once agricultural community was made more attractive with the development of the two interstates which make Cranberry Township a commuter option. Those looking to escape the hustle and bustle of the big city yet remain accessible to it are drawn to Cranberry. Today, the population of Cranberry Township continues to climb by attracting newcomers with its top-notch community amenities, job opportunities, and welcoming atmosphere. From children to adults, Cranberry has a way for just about every member of the community to get involved. The Cranberry Public Library and the Cranberry Township Municipal Center provide everything from early education programs to athletic classes and leagues. Other exciting places include the waterpark, disc golf course, athletic fields, and a golf course. The rest of Cranberry consists of tree-lined streets holding plenty of rental options.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
